The North Carolina Tar Heels and the Virginia Cavaliers meet in college basketball action from the John Paul Jones Arena on Tuesday night.

The North Carolina Tar Heels will look to build on back-to-back wins after an 81-64 win over Notre Dame last time out. Armando Bacot has 18.8 PPG and 11.2 RPG to lead the Tar Heels in scoring and on the glass, averaging a double-double per game while Caleb Love has 16.9 PPG with 3.3 APG and 4 RPG. R.J. Davis has 16.4 PPG with 5.3 RPG and a team-high 3.4 APG while Pete Nance has 10.9 PPG to cap off the group of double-digit scorers for North Carolina up to this point in the season. Leaky Black also has 7.3 PPG and 6.1 RPG for the Tar Heels this season. As a team, North Carolina is averaging 81.4 PPG on 46.2% shooting from the field, 31.9% from behind the arc and 73.5% from the foul line this season.

The Virginia Cavaliers will try to build on their 73-66 win over Syracuse last time out. Kihei Clark has a team-high 11.4 PPG and 6.3 APG to lead Virginia in scoring and assists up to this point in the season while Jayden Gardner has 11.3 PPG and a team-high 5.3 RPG. Armaan Franklin has 11.3 PPG with 3.7 RPG to cap off the scoring in double figures for Virginia so far this year. As a team, Virginia is averaging 70 PPG on 45.8% shooting from the field, 38% from three and 70.7a% from the foul line this season.

North Carolina is 1-5-1 ATS in their last 7 road games and 2-7-1 ATS in their last 10 games against a team with a winning percentage above .600 while the over is 6-0 in their last 6 games overall. Virginia is 1-9 ATS in their last 10 games overall and 0-6 ATS in their last 6 home games while the under is 4-0-1 in their last 5 games against a team with a winning record.

I get the case to be made either way, but I’m leaning towards Virginia in this one. The Tar Heels still have massive issues defensively, and while Virginia’s been brutal ATS this season, a lot of it has to do with a defense-first Virginia team being asked to lay too many points or are an underdog in spots where it’s warranted against teams like Houston. I just don’t see North Carolina being able to make up for their shortcomings with the offense against this Cavalier defense. I think Virginia gets the win and cover in this one so I’ll lay it and play it with Virginia here.
